How many meter of air in 1 newton/square millimeter? The answer is 78880.172892718. We assume you are converting between meter of air [0 °C] and newton/square millimetre. You can view more details on each measurement unit: meter of air or newton/square millimeter The SI derived unit for pressure is the pascal. 1 pascal is equal to 0.078880172892718 meter of air, or 1.0E-6 newton/square millimeter.
